Sales Development Representative (SDR) Lead
Join the planet’s most important fight
Normative is now looking for a Sales Development Representative (SDR) Lead for our team in London
Normative helps companies to understand and reduce their carbon footprints towards their journey to Net Zero. We do this through science-based carbon accounting products and tailored advice from net zero experts. What we do has a real positive impact on the climate - you can too!
Our Sales team is now growing and we’re looking for a passionate and driven leader to join our growing team in the London office and make a real impact on the fight against climate change. As SDR Lead, you will play a crucial role in helping companies achieve their NetZero goals and contribute to a sustainable future.
About the Role As a SDR Lead, you will be responsible for developing and managing a team of 6 SDRs, enabling them to hit their monthly goals and grow the business. You will optimise outbound sales strategy, provide hands-on coaching, and collaborate closely with sales and marketing leadership.
What you will do:
• Team Leadership: Manage and lead a team of SDRs (including hiring and onboarding talent when needed), providing guidance, motivation, and mentorship to help the team meet and exceed lead generation goals. Provide regular training, 1:1 coaching, and feedback to help team members improve their skills in cold calling, lead qualification, and email outreach. Share best practices and sales techniques.
• Outbound Strategy: Develop and implement outbound prospecting strategies for identifying and qualifying leads to ensure a consistent pipeline of high-quality opportunities.
• Performance Management: Monitor and evaluate the team’s performance, ensuring that individual and team KPIs (e.g., calls, emails, meetings booked, SAOs) are consistently met.
• Cross-functional Collaboration: Work closely with the wider sales leadership team, marketing, and operations teams to ensure smooth alignment on strategy, process, and effective use of tools (i.e. Salesforce CRM).
• CRM & Reporting: Ensure the SDR team accurately inputs sales activities in our Salesforce CRM, and uses additional sales engagement tools effectively. Regularly report on team performance, lead quality, and pipeline health to senior leadership. Continuously analyse and optimise outreach processes, tools, and techniques to increase team efficiency and lead generation effectiveness.
• Market Insights: Stay up-to-date on the latest trends and best practices in sustainability, and the competitive landscape.
What you'll bring:
• 2-3 years experience in a SDR role, with a proven track record of meeting or exceeding targets in a B2B SaaS environment.
• Prior experience managing or mentoring junior team members, or acting as a lead within a sales team.
• Strong understanding of outbound sales processes, prospecting tools, and lead qualification techniques.
• Excellent communication, coaching, and interpersonal skills.
• Experience with CRM software (e.g., Salesforce) and sales engagement tools (e.g., Outreach, Gong).
• Target-obsessed mindset with a focus on continuous improvement and team development.
- Adaptability and ability to thrive in a dynamic environment. You embrace change, learn quickly, and think on your feet as needed
- A passion for sustainability and a desire to make a positive impact on the world.
